Wrongs Act 1958 - SECT 24AP
Part not to affect other liability
24AP. Part not to affect other liability
Nothing in this Part-
(a) prevents a person from being held vicariously liable for a proportion
of any apportionable claim for which another person is liable; or
(b) prevents a person from being held jointly and severally liable for the
damages awarded against another person as agent of the person; or
(c) prevents a partner from being held jointly and severally liable with
another partner for that proportion of an apportionable claim for
which the other partner is liable; or
(d) prevents a court from awarding exemplary or punitive damages against a
defendant in a proceeding; or
(e) affects the operation of any other Act to the extent that it imposes
several liability on any person in respect of what would otherwise be
an apportionable claim.
